What is another word for bug eyed?

Pronunciation: [bˈʌɡ ˈa͡ɪd] (IPA)

The term 'bug eyed' refers to a person or animal with eyes that are protruding or bulging outwards. Some synonyms for this term include 'pop-eyed', 'googly-eyed', 'protruding-eyed', 'bulging-eyed', 'buggy-eyed', 'staring-eyed', and 'boss-eyed'. These words are used to describe the appearance of someone who looks surprised, afraid or bewildered. These terms can also be used to describe characters in cartoons or caricatures, exaggerating the size and shape of their eyes to create humorous and exaggerated expressions. Regardless of the synonym used, all these terms convey a sense of intense or extreme emotions visible in a person's eyes.
